My question is if for video schema to work is needed for the video to be on your website or you can do a video schema with a youtube video from your youtube channel

You can implement schema was almost any kind of video embed, including an embedded YouTube video.
However, if your focus is on trying to get rich snippets in the search results, you'll be best of not using YouTube (more details here: http://moz.com/blog/building-a-video-seo-strategy)

Schema.org for real estate portal
I am looking for advise on how to best start adopting schema.org for a real estate portal. Would like to get feedback and suggestions on my initial thoughts. Here are the obvious ones: 1. http://www.schema.org/RealEstateAgent(Thing > Organization > LocalBusiness > RealEstateAgent) Plan to use this to wrap realtors' information.We ll start with their profile page but possibly also on other pages with their information (e.g. listing page) 2. http://www.schema.org/SearchResultsPage(Thing > CreativeWork > WebPage > SearchResultsPage) This will mark search results pages where e.g. multiple listings of certain type in certain area are presented. 3. http://schema.org/WebPage(Thing > CreativeWork > WebPage) Pretty generic so we are thinking of using it on every page. e.g. significantLinks and breadcrumb objects seem like they could help in marking important links that will help search engines understand the site's information architecture better. I am not sure how to treat property listings Offer seems a good fit (http://www.schema.org/Offer) but not perfect. maybe it should be combined with place (http://www.schema.org/Place) http://www.schema.org/GeoCoordinates could also be used to mark each listing's location on the map. any thoughts or experiences you would like to share?
